Blastco is an industrial finishing company in Wentzville, Missouri, serving manufacturers, fabricators, OEMs, distributors, and government customers throughout the St. Louis region and beyond.
Since 1989, we have provided abrasive blasting, powder coating, and industrial painting for everything from recurring production parts to large fabricated assemblies and specialized industrial projects.
Industrial Finishing Under One Roof
Our facility combines abrasive blasting, powder coating, and liquid industrial painting in one location. Keeping surface preparation and coating operations together allows us to control the process from the incoming part through final inspection.

Abrasive Blasting
We provide abrasive blasting for steel, stainless steel, aluminum, and other substrates using a range of blast media and surface preparation standards. Work includes both general industrial preparation and specified surface profiles and cleanliness requirements.
Powder Coating
Our powder coating operation handles individual fabricated parts, large assemblies, long products, and recurring production runs. Multiple large curing ovens and overhead handling system allow us to process parts and product lengths beyond the capacity of many conventional powder coating lines.
Industrial Painting
We apply a wide range of industrial coating systems, including epoxies, urethanes, zinc-rich primers, high-temperature coatings, military-specification systems, fluoropolymers, and other specialty coatings.
